  <title><![CDATA[What Happens When You Put Evolution on Replay?]]></title>
  <body><![CDATA[<p>If you could rewind time and let evolution happen all over again, would the end result resemble life as we know it? This is no longer a theoretical question. While he was at Georgia Tech,&nbsp;<a href="http://www.biosci.gatech.edu/">School of Biological Sciences&#39;</a>&nbsp;&nbsp;<a href="http://www.gauchergroup.biology.gatech.edu/">Eric Gaucher</a> worked with <a href="https://kacarlab.org/betul/">Betul Kacar</a> on a NASA-funded project to replay evolution again and again with the bacterium E. coli, rewinding the evolution of a specific key protein that the bacteria needed to survive.</p>
